The theoretical radar meteors Range Distribution Model of overdense
to observed range distributions of meteors belonging to the Quadrantid,
Perseid, Leonid, Geminid, γ Draconid (Giacobinid),
ζ Perseid
and β Taurid streams to study the variability of the flux density,
Θm0, and the mass distribution index, s, i.e., the parameters
inherent to the inner structure of meteor streams. With the exception of
the Perseids 1988-1993 no systematic variability of
Θm0 was found in
any of the above-named showers. The values of s were found to be higher
than those of other authors working with radar data and using Kaiser's
formula for its determination. The possible cause is also discussed in
this work. The weighted means of both parameters valid for each stream
were evaluated. They can be considered as representative of each shower.
